- New accounting software, Deltek GCS Premier, a fully
integrated project-based accounting system that is recognized
by the DCAA as a highly effective, reliable software with
the ability to perform cost-plus and fee-based contracts.
Used by government contracting firms since 1983, Deltek
GCS Premier was developed in conjunction with FAR and CAS
regulations and is designed to be compliant with DCAA audit
requirements. The software offers audit trail visibility
in all aspects of labor charging and non-labor expenditures.
It has full automation of FFP, CPFF and T&M billing
with support documentation, timely project cost reporting,
and budget-versus-actual analysis.
